After a bit of dimpling, we riveted and bolted the tailcone to the fuselage! YIPPEEEEEE! pretty sweet if you ask me. after that, we got to work on the baggage floor area, and the baggage door frame. nothing too spectacular here, just deburr, drill, dimple. it's nice to finally stiffen up this area though. the fuselage skin where the baggage door cutout is was soooo flimsy for soooo long, i kept worrying about accidentally bending or screwing up this area. now, it's all riveted together, and with the door frame in place, it's nice and sturdy.
